      Amazon interviews FAQs

      • Learning Associate applicants have rated the interview process at Amazon with 3.6 out of 5 (where 5 is the highest level of difficulty) and assessed their interview experience as 60% positive. To compare, the company-average is 57.5% positive. This is according to Glassdoor user ratings.
      • Candidates applying for Learning Associate roles take an average of 46 days to get hired, when considering 5 user submitted interviews for this role. To compare, the hiring process at Amazon overall takes an average of 28 days.
      • Common stages of the interview process at Amazon as a Learning Associate according to 5 Glassdoor interviews include:

        Phone interview:  38%

        Presentation:  15%

        Skills test:  15%

        Group panel interview:  8%

        Background check:  8%

        Personality test:  8%

        One on one interview:  8%

      Interview

      Follow STAR Method interview prep will be given from the team. Its based on each level - L4 onwards is the managerial positions and benefits.Prepare in Advance: Review common behavioral interview questions and think of examples from your past experiences that demonstrate relevant skills and qualities. Be Specific: Provide detailed and specific examples for each part of the STAR method. Use real-life situations from your work, school, or volunteer experiences. Focus on Your Actions: While it's important to provide context for the situation, make sure the bulk of your answer focuses on what you did and how you contributed to the outcome. Highlight Results: Emphasize the positive results or outcomes of your actions. If possible, quantify your achievements with numbers or percentages. Practice: Practice using the STAR method with a friend, family member, or career counselor. The more you practice, the more confident you'll become in using this technique during your interviews. Listen Carefully: During the interview, listen carefully to the questions and make sure your responses directly address what the interviewer is asking. Be Concise: While you want to provide enough detail to fully answer the question, try to keep your responses concise and focused. Stay Positive: Even if you're discussing a challenging situation, try to frame your response in a positive light and focus on what you learned or accomplished.
